Regents of the University of Wisconsin ... Use the Undergraduate Non-Resident Estimate. Tuition & Fees are waived for exchange students. Exchange students are not charged the International Student Fee. Students will need to provide documentation of a minimum amount of funds usable for living expenses in order to qualify for the J-1 visa. If you have not received aid in the past, you may still be eligible for financial aid to help with your study abroad expenses.Award amounts vary based on the length of the program: Winter Intersession/Spring Break/Summer 3 weeks or less: $1,500. Summer more than 3 weeks: $2,000. Semester: $2,500. Academic Year: $4,000. These funds are based on financial need and require interested students to complete the FAFSA.
